From American Ballet Theatre press release:

CASTING ANNOUNCED FOR FIRST TWO WEEKS OF

AMERICAN BALLET THEATRE’S 2006 NEW YORK CITY CENTER SEASON

Casting for the first two weeks of American Ballet Theatre’s 2006 season at NY City Center was announced today by Artistic Director Kevin McKenzie.

American Ballet Theatre’s Fall 2006 season will open on Wednesday, October 18 at 6:30 pm with a gala performance highlighted by the Revival Premiere of Twyla Tharp’s Sinatra Suite featuring Herman Cornejo in the leading role and the first movement from George Balanchine’s Symphonie Concertante with Michele Wiles and Veronika Part in the leading roles. ABT’s opening night will also include the pas de deux from Lar Lubovitch’s Meadow performed by Julie Kent and Marcelo Gomes, Diana and Acteon Pas de Deux performed by Xiomara Reyes and Jose Manuel Carreño, Swan Lake, Act II Pas de Deux with Paloma Herrera and Maxim Beloserkovsky and a performance of Tharp’s In the Upper Room.

A new work by Jorma Elo will receive its World Premiere on Thursday, October 19. The evening will also feature the debut of Jose Manuel Carreño in Sinatra Suite, the pas de deux from Tharp’s Known By Heart performed by Irina Dvorovenko and Maxim Beloserkovsy, and Kurt Jooss’ The Green Table, featuring David Hallberg in the leading role of Death.

The first week at NY City Center will also be highlighted by the Revival Premieres of Symphonie Concertante and Mark Morris’ Drink To Me Only With Thine Eyes, as well as the season’s first performances of Agnes de Mille’s Rodeo. Debut performances for the first week include Gennadi Saveliev in Symphonie Concertante on Friday, October 20 and Michele Wiles, Marcelo Gomes and Veronika Part in the leading roles at the matinee on Saturday,

October 21. Marian Butler will make her New York debut as The Cowgirl in Rodeo on Saturday evening, October 21.

American Ballet Theatre’s second week at NY City Center includes the Revival Premiere of Lubovitch’s Meadow on Tuesday evening, October 24, the Revival Premiere of Stanton Welch’s Clear featuring Julie Kent and Angel Corella in the leading roles on

Thursday evening, October 26, and the season’s first performances of Jerome Robbins’ Afternoon of a Faun and Fancy Free on the same evening. Jose Manuel Carreño will make his New York debut in Afternoon of a Faun at the matinee on Sunday, October 29.

Debuts scheduled for the second week include Maxim Beloserkovsky in Symphonie Concertante on Wednesday evening, October 25, Marcelo Gomes in Sinatra Suite on Thursday evening, October 26, and Stella Abrera and David Hallberg in Meadow on Friday evening, October 27.

Xiomara Reyes and Herman Cornejo will dance the leading roles in Clear for the first time at the matinee on Saturday October 28, and Irina Dvorovenko and Gillian Murphy will debut in Symphonie Concertante in the evening. The Sunday matinee performance on October 29 will feature Angel Corella in the lead role of Sinatra Suite.
